Definitions for symmetric
  • Symmetral (a.) - Commensurable; symmetrical.
  • Symmetric (a.) - Symmetrical.
  • Symmetrical (a.) - Involving or exhibiting symmetry; proportional in parts; having its parts in due proportion as to dimensions; as, a symmetrical body or building.
  • Symmetrical (a.) - Having the organs or parts of one side corresponding with those of the other; having the parts in two or more series of organs the same in number; exhibiting a symmetry. See Symmetry, 2.
  • Symmetrical (a.) - Having an equal number of parts in the successive circles of floral organs; -- said of flowers.
  • Symmetrical (a.) - Having a likeness in the form and size of floral organs of the same kind; regular.
  • Symmetrical (a.) - Having a common measure; commensurable.
  • Symmetrical (a.) - Having corresponding parts or relations.
